Guide Note: Claudia Schiffer was born August 25, 1970, in Rheinberg,
Germany. She is known to the world as an actress and supermodel. She is the oldest of four siblings.
Before becoming a model, she wanted to become a lawyer. In 1987, that changed when she was discovered by Michel Levaton in a nightclub. After this encounter she was signed up to become a model and rest is history. In her career she has graced the cover pages of over 900 magazines and has became a world famous supermodel. She has modeled for many companies such as Guess, Revlon, L'Oreal and even Pepsi.
Claudia Schiffer not only models, but she also acts. She has appeared in a variety of movies and television series. Her very first film role was in 1994s Richie Rich. Other films she can be seen in include: Blackout, Love Actually and Life Without Dick. Television series she has appeared in include: Arrested Development, Dharma & Greg and How I Met Your Mother. Claudia Schiffer has also appeared on late night talks shows and award shows such as French Fashion Awards.
Claudia Schiffer is married to film producer Matthew Vaughn. She currently has two children. Her current residence is in London.
Claudia Schiffer Fast Facts:
- Born: August 25, 1970
- Birthplace: Rheinberg, Germany
- Height: 5' 11
- Spouse: Matthew Vaughn
- Children: 2
- Appeared on over 900 magazine covers
- Didn't get her ears pierced until 2006, for Accessorize photoshoot
- UNICEF volunteer
- Oldest of 4 children
- Was once sawed in half by magician David Copperfield
